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Учебное пособие 3000507.doc
Скачиваний:
32
Добавлен:
30.04.2022
Размер:
7.92 Mб
Скачать

1.6.2. Разбор решений задач по логике предикатов

1. Установим истинность следующих логических выражений путем конкрети­зации. Для варианта 10 имеем следующее тождество:

Доказательство:

Для варианта 19 имеем следующую клаузу:

Для доказательства ее истинности избавимся от кванторов в обеих частях кла­узы:

Последняя клауза верна в силу аксиомы порядка

2. Решения для второго задания приведем для всех вариантов. Ответы не трудно будет отыскать, если знать, каким образом были составлены логические выражения. Замена в соответствии с принципом двойственности предполагает одновременную перестановку местами всех заключений и всех посылок, а также замену обозначений.

Для варианта 1 из принципа двойственности по варианту 9

Для варианта 2

Для варианта 3. из принципа двойственности по варианту2. Для варианта 4 из принципа двойственности по варианту 10. Для варианта 5

Для варианта 6 из принципа двойственности по варианту 13. Для варианта 7 из принципа двойственности по варианту 12. Для варианта 8:

Для варианта 9 по клаузе 8 со следующими обозначениями

Для варианта 10.

Для варианта 11 из принципа двойственности

по варианту 5.

Для варианта 12 по клаузе 10 со следующими обозначениями:

Для варианта 13:

Для варианта 14: из принципа двойственности по варианту 16.

Для варианта 15: из принципа двойственности по варианту 8.

Для варианта 16: по клаузе 13 со следующими обозначениями:

Для варианта 17:

Для варианта 18:

Для варианта 19.

Для варианта 20

Для варианта 21:

Для варианта 22:

Для варианта 23:

Для варианта 24 из принципа двойственности по варианту 21.

Для варианта 25:

3. Для легенды варианта 2 практического задания п. 1.7 (3) введем следующие предикаты:

Области определения переменных:

Посылки.

Если некоторый х уважает некоторого у по причине некоторого z, то первый всегда окажет второму конкретную материальную помощь, если имеется определенная вероятность того, что у как-то компенсирует затраты х.

Из приведенной легенды следует, что бизнесмен уважает художника за его мастерство:

Понятно также, что бизнесмен будет иметь добрую репутацию мецената за то, что он помог художнику в организации выставки его картин:

Заключение: бизнесмен поможет художнику организовать выставку его картин:

Доказать истинность составленной из этих предикатов клаузы не составит большого труда.

Для легенды варианта 5 практического задания п. 1.7 (3) можно ввести следующие предикаты:

Области:

Посылки:

Все х извергают какие-то

Если некоторые х извергают какие-то у, то будет высокая урожайность.

Высокая урожайность всегда несет благо людям:

Заключение: то, что источником блага является господь бог, не противоречит исходным посылкам:

Доказательство очевидно.

4. Произведем трассировку работы ПРОЛОГ-программы «Родственные отношения» для первой цели варианта 12. Для этого имеющуюся программу дополним клаузой

Цель: 85)свекор (Петр, у).

Трассировка программы.

Из соответствующих фактов и правил составим противоречие.

Целевой дизъюнкт нейтрализуется предикатами под номерами 47, 44 и 65, когда переменные принимают конкретные значения

БИБЛИОГРАФИЧЕСКИЙ СПИСОК

1. Судоплатов С.В., Овчинникова Е.В. Элементы дискретной математики. М.: Наука,2002.

2. Нефедов В.Н., Осипова В.А. Курс дискретной математики. Мю: Изд-во МАИ, 1992.

3. Новиков Ф.А. Дискретная математика для программистов. СПб. Питер, 2001.

4. Москинова Г.И. Дискретная математика дляменеджера. М.: Логос, 2002.

5. Стол Р. Множества. Логика. Аксиоматическая теория. М.: Просвкщение, 1968.

6. Кузнецов О.П., Адельсон-Вельский Г.М. Дискретная математика для инженера. М.: Энергоатомиздат, 1989.

7. Лавров И.А., Максимова Л.Л. Задачи по теории множеств, математической логике и теории алгоритмов. М.: Физматлит, 2001.

8. Акимов О.Е. Дискретная математика. Логика, группы, графы. М.: лаборатория базовых знаний, 2001.

СОДЕРЖАНИЕ

Введение 3